Nadine Road in Penn Hills closed due to landslide
Nadine Road between Allegheny River Boulevard and Lincoln Road in Penn Hills is closed due to a landslide.
Allegheny County Public Works officials said the slide occurred Friday afternoon.
It overturned a retaining wall and caused a portion of the road to collapse.
Officials plan to bring in a consultant to help determine what work will be needed to remediate the area and to ensure that the road is safe for vehicles.
There’s no word on when it would be repaired or reopened.
The same section of road was closed Thursday due to flooding following morning storms and was reopened later that evening.
